Transaction e25faff1689a917149bf942a3fde6feb6741316c8dce23a6bb172136b6e8439b
1 Input
1 Output
-
e25faff1689a917149bf942a3fde6feb6741316c8dce23a6bb172136b6e8439b:0
- value
- 697726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f746267c2ebb9c5f09ddcc72e81dc533c0731da OP_EQUAL
- address
- 3DJwASEHpko8E24RzctgDe1iS34xEXdXUu